Lyman’s location along Maine’s northeast coastal zone shapes a unique profile of water damage risks not often seen in other parts of the country. With an annual rainfall totaling approximately 46.4 inches, notably above the broader U.S. average of 30 to 40 inches, moisture intrusion is a persistent concern rather than a seasonal anomaly. This environment fosters conditions where water-related issues are a frequent challenge for homeowners.
Primary among the risks are the nor’easters, powerful storms that combine heavy precipitation, high winds, and freezing temperatures. These storms commonly trigger ice dams on rooftops, leading to leaks and water infiltration beneath shingles and into attics. Simultaneously, the threat of frozen pipes bursting during prolonged cold spells adds another layer of vulnerability to Lyman’s housing stock. As pipes freeze and expand, sudden ruptures can release significant volumes of water inside walls or basements.
The area’s designation as a high-risk flood zone further intensifies the threat landscape. Coastal flooding, either from storm surges or seasonal snowmelt, can lead to basement inundation and foundation water entry. This risk is corroborated by York County’s record of 14 federally declared water emergencies, showcasing a pattern of recurring serious water-related incidents. The most recent federal disaster declaration in 2023 highlights that these dangers remain current and pressing.

Imagine a sudden pipe rupture in your Lyman home releasing water across multiple rooms. Knowing how your insurance responds can make a critical difference in managing the financial aftermath. In Maine, standard homeowner insurance policies generally cover abrupt and accidental water damage caused by plumbing failures, appliance malfunctions, or storm-related leaks. However, coverage often excludes gradual deterioration and flooding from coastal surges or river overflow, requiring separate flood insurance.
Policyholders in Maine must be aware of a six-year window to file claims for water damage events, a timeframe that underscores the importance of timely documentation and reporting. Homeowners should capture photographic evidence, keep repair estimates, and maintain detailed records of communication with contractors and insurers to support their case effectively.
The financial burden from water damage can be significant, especially when major repairs approach $58,000, nearly eight months of a typical household’s income in Lyman. While insurance can alleviate some of this, deductibles and coverage limits mean homeowners often bear part of the cost. Understanding what falls inside or outside policy boundaries enables better budgeting and decision-making.
For properties in Lyman’s high flood-risk zones, securing a separate flood insurance policy is essential, as standard plans exclude these losses. Homeowners should also review their coverage for potential gaps related to water backup from sewer lines or sump pump failures, as these perils may require additional endorsements.

Water damage expenses can vary widely, but what should Lyman homeowners realistically anticipate when budgeting for repairs? Understanding local cost ranges tied to damage severity offers valuable insight for financial planning. In Lyman, the typical outlay for minor water intrusion events begins around $1,400 and can climb to $5,800. Moderate damage typically runs from $5,800 up to $17,500, while major incidents may cost between $17,500 and $58,200. These figures reflect a local cost multiplier of about 1.16 times the national average, influenced by regional labor rates and material availability.
When contextualizing these costs, the median home value in Lyman sits near $349,529, making a major water damage event potentially equal to roughly 17% of a home's worth. For a family earning the area's median income of $87,284, a $58,200 restoration represents close to eight months of earnings, underscoring the financial significance of substantial water damage. These numbers emphasize the importance of adequate preparation rather than unexpected crisis response.
Local climate and housing stock contribute to the cost variability. For example, a common scenario might involve a roof leak caused by ice damming during winter storms—a frequent challenge in Lyman’s northeast coastal climate. The resulting water infiltration can damage insulation, drywall, and structural wood, requiring comprehensive mitigation. On the other hand, a malfunction of a water heater or a washing machine hose rupture inside a basement might result in less extensive, more manageable repair needs.

How frequently do significant water-related emergencies affect the Lyman area? York County’s history reveals a persistent pattern, with 14 federally recognized water-related disasters recorded over recent decades. This count surpasses the national county average of approximately 8 to 12 such events, indicating that serious water damage incidents are a recurring challenge rather than isolated anomalies.
Among these 14 emergency declarations, six involved flooding, and five were tied to hurricanes or tropical storm impacts. The remainder included other severe water intrusion events. This distribution reflects the dual hazards of coastal storm surges and heavy inland precipitation that the region experiences. Notably, four of these federally coordinated responses have occurred since 2010, demonstrating an accelerating trend in water disaster frequency over the last decade.
The most recent federally declared disaster occurred in 2023, underscoring that water threats remain highly relevant for homeowners today. The typical home in Lyman was constructed around 1973, placing much of the housing stock in the category of aging properties where original infrastructure elements may be approaching the end of their effective lifespan. Homes built in this era frequently retain plumbing systems, water heaters, and roofing materials that are susceptible to failure after several decades of service, increasing the likelihood of water intrusion events.
Specifically, many houses from the early 1970s still incorporate galvanized steel pipes, which are prone to internal corrosion and eventual leaks. The risk of supply line deterioration is compounded by foundation settling that can stress plumbing connections. Roofs installed during this period may also not meet current standards for ice dam resistance, leaving attics vulnerable to moisture from winter storms common to the region.
Approximately 6.1% of Lyman’s housing consists of mobile or manufactured homes, which present distinctive water damage challenges. These structures often have lower elevation and are more susceptible to flooding from heavy precipitation or snowmelt accumulation. The materials used in mobile homes can be less resilient to prolonged moisture exposure, and their plumbing and electrical connections may be more vulnerable to freezing conditions.
Multi-unit buildings, which make up about 20.9% of local residences, introduce complexities due to shared walls and plumbing systems. A leak in one unit can quickly propagate to adjacent spaces, escalating the scope of damage. Such layouts require coordinated maintenance and rapid response to prevent minor leaks from becoming widespread issues.
